By EVDOguy(noreply@blogger.com) As we suspected they might, Verizon has lowered their overage charges for their EVDO Mobile Broadband service. The Verizon 5GB/mo data plan used to have a $250/GB overage charge, and should now only be $50/GB -- which matches that of EVDO competitor Sprint.

San Diego kicks off the fastest wireless broadband service in the US. Sprint's EVDO Revision A promises average download speeds of 450-800 kbps and average upload speeds of 300-400 kbps and will hit a number of other US cities soon. Here is a list of other cities who can expect blazing fast br...
